Frosty pops up at Southwell

N0393411328639930183A

Mister Frosty provided a victory that was both topical and emotional for George Prodromou when scooting six lengths clear in division two of the Place Only Betting At bluesq.com Amateur Riders' Handicap at Southwell.

The grey was involved in a nasty incident on a journey home from the racecourse last summer, and the Norfolk trainer was delighted to see him romp home at 11-2 in the hands of David Dunsdon.

"He had been working very well, as they all have been, and to be honest we couldn't hear of defeat. We got a good boy on board and he gave him a lovely ride. He'll run again at Lingfield on Saturday, and Kieren Fallon will ride," he said.

"He ran at Folkestone last summer and we put him in the box to go home, but something upset him and he jumped across the partition in the box. He was stuck for two and a half hours, the vets came and said the horse was going to die. We got him out and his owner has been very patient. It brought a tear to my eye."

Aqua Ardens defied 1-8 favourite Derivatives in the Golf Before Racing At Southwell Maiden Stakes. The pair had it between them throughout the six furlongs, but Aqua Ardens (8-1) showed a greater determination under Stephen Craine to finish half a length ahead.

Trainer George Baker said: "It's the oldest cliche in racing, but you should never be afraid of one horse. I didn't think the favourite was absolutely bomb-proof and it worked out. My wife Candida is riding in the charity race at the Cheltenham Festival and I suppose he could be a possible ride, although I have other options."

There was a Royal Ascot winner in action, even if Drawnfromthepast's greatest moment came in the dim and distant past of the 2007 Windsor Castle Stakes.

Back with original trainer Jamie Osborne and now carrying the silks of Dr Marwan Koukash, the 4-6 favourite had little problem in making it back-to-back victories at basement level in the Southwell Golf Club Members Selling Stakes.

Samasana (9-2) claimed the Book Your Tickets On-Line At southwell-racecourse.co.uk Maiden Handicap, with Laura's Bairn (10-1) making all the running under Freddie Tylicki in the Golf And Racing At Southwell Handicap.

Bandstand (12-1) called the tune in the Thousands Of Sports Experiences At bluesq.com Handicap, while the show was closed in the Play Rainbow Riches At bluesq.com Handicap by Alan Swinbank's Tricksofthetrade (9-2).
